We are having issues getting our HMDA data to the FRB. We have sent twice via US Mail and once UPS on a diskette but have been notified each time that the data was "rendered unreadable during the mailing and/or security screening process." These have all been new disks and the processed worked fine on our CRA data. Our data is on a stand alone without internet access so the internet route is not an option.

Anyone else having these issues - any suggestions?

Create your disk just like you have. Then put that disk into a computer that does have internet access (surely someone in the bank has internet access, otherwise, how would you be posting here). Download the FFIEC software onto that computer, import the data from your disk, create the encrypted file and e-mail it to the FRB submission e-mail address.
